Introducing Project ‘Magi’
Google’s project ‘Magi’ represents a significant step towards achieving the company’s vision of a more visually appealing, snackable, personalised, and human search engine. The Wall Street Journal reported that ‘Magi’ will allow users to engage in conversations with the search engine, signaling a departure from the static, one-way nature of traditional search results. By infusing human voices into search results, Google aims to create a more relatable and personalised search experience.
